    DMA2100 Music Library not recognizing media changes

    Is this how it's supposed to work?

    I want to fix the id3 info on my music, so on the VMC I open Media Player and change all the info that I want.  (Specifically, the genres of all my music was fooked up.)  Now, on the VMC the music is ordered properly by genre, but on the extender the old genres still exist.

    The extender will find new items and play everything correctly, but the genres are all screwed up.

    Re: DMA2100 Music Library not recognizing media changes

    Each extender has its own Library; chnages to the main PC library re not reflected in the Extenders.

    You can delete the extender's Library file from the hard disk, which makes it rebuild it from scratch.

    Sorry for the delay.

    I just wanted to update the thread with the info that this procedure works just fine.

    Be sure you can view hidden files and folders.

    The location of the "currentdatabase_360" on my VMC is slightly different.  The path is:

    c:\users\mcx1-***\app data\local\microsoft\media player\
